			<description>&#60;p&#62;I just turned in a Blacktip Shark.  Sadly I wasn't first.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;However, I can confirm that the consolation quest &#34;Better Luck Next Time&#34; does give some Kalu'ak rep.  Very little though:  it was 172 for me, and thats with +5% from a guild perk, and using a human character.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;My Kalu'ak rep was at 0 in the Neutral section before this.  I doubt there would have been more rep gained from this if I had been in a different rep category but I'm putting this here in case.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;If the rep bonuses work together like I think they do (i.e. totalling 15%), that'd mean the regular rep gain is 150.&#60;br /&#62;
I did:&#60;br /&#62;
172 ÷ 1.15 = 149.5652....&#60;br /&#62;
so I checked&#60;br /&#62;
150 x 1.15 and got 172.5.   So I think my calculation works.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;TL;DR version:&#60;br /&#62;
The consolation quest &#34;Better Luck Next Time&#34; for turning in a Blacktip Shark after someone else wins gives 150 Kalu'ak rep.

&#60;p&#62;I won't bore anyone with my location - That sort of stuff doesn't mean anything as more people moving to a location makes it bad.  I will tell you my theory about server populations.  As a server becomes more populous and more people compete in the STVFE, the virtue having a large number of pools (from henceforth let's call that a group of pools) in a small area increases.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;Now, obviously having a large number of pools in a small location is ALWAYS a virtue, but bear me out:  A group of pools, say 5-7 within 10 seconds of 310% flight away from each other, even when you've got a couple of people fishing at them, is, indeed, going to deplete fairly quickly.  But during a heavy STVFE, those pools are going to respawn even faster!&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;How can you leverage this?  Don't move around a lot.  The virtue of moving between groups of pools decreases as you get more and more people on the server because you have less time to wait for a respawn.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;Also, on a heavy STVFE, I'd advise you to find an extreme area.  What do I mean?  Well, you can look at the locations you fish as continuous strips of land, ones that terminate at natural locations, like Booty Bay to Hardwrench, Wild Shore to Crystal Vein, Zul'Kunda to the Vortex.  What I advise is you pick a spot near the ENDS of those strips.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;&#34;But, that means you only have one direction to search for more pools!&#34; Yes, that's true. And that's a real disadvantage.  However there is an upside:  Everybody else has only one direction to go as well, so as a result most of those people who start out near you are going to do what's rational, and work their way toward the middles of those strips of land.  This is only natural - They're forced to move toward the middle whenever they're at one of the two ends, and eventually if you assume they take a random walk from there, half of them will work their way toward the middle while the other half will immediately jam up against the end, only to be forced to head back toward the center.  The point is if you assume the competitors take a random walk, the ends will gradually deplete.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;My point is during a heavy STVFE the disadvantage of having only one place to search for pools is mitigated by the high respawn rate, and is eventually superseded by the advantage of having people inexorably abandon your pool group, despite the excellent respawn rate.  I basically won three times whilst fishing the same 7 pools.
